Transaction 2376435e012d6bcb4e9cf025207bad759814777ace074b86bfbf90710182ac99
1 Input
1 Output
-
2376435e012d6bcb4e9cf025207bad759814777ace074b86bfbf90710182ac99:0
- value
- 49386649
- script pubkey
- OP_0 OP_PUSHBYTES_20 b40177f8dabef172af1781b49cfbd44964cf5d78
- address
- bc1qksqh07x6hmch9tchsx6fe775f9jv7htch59ztx